Aout World Logic Day: Despite its undeniable relevance to the development of knowledge, sciences and technologies, there is little public awareness on the importance of logic. The proclamation of World Logic Day by UNESCO, in association with the International Council for Philosophy and Human Sciences (CIPSH), intends to bring the intellectual history, conceptual significance and practical implications of logic to the attention of interdisciplinary science communities and the broader public. World Logic Day is hosted in 33+ countries around the world during the month of January as a reminder of the importance of UN SDG 16 around world peace and UN SDG 17 around better collaboration.
